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Whitton (London) to Baillieston start from as little as £54.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Everything you need to know about Whitton (London) Station

Discover The Charm of Whitton (London) Train Station

Nestled in the suburban tranquility of the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ames, Whitton (London) train station is a cozy transit point that acts as a gateway to the bustling energy of central London and beyond. Ideal for commuters and casual travelers alike, the station is situated on the Hounslow Loop Line, providing convenient access to numerous destinations.

Modern Facilities at Whitton (London) Train Station

Whitton (London) station is designed to cater to a diverse range of passengers. It provides essential facilities including ticket machines, with accessible options available for those travelling with a Disabled Persons Railcard. The ticket office is operational from early morning until late on weekdays and slightly adjusted hours over the weekend, ensuring passengers can purchase or collect tickets at their convenience. For those who prefer a cashless experience, smartcard validators are available to streamline your journey.

Accessibility is a notable feature at Whitton (London). The station proudly offers step-free access to all platforms, making travel seamless for individuals with mobility challenges. Accessible toilets are available adjacent to the ticket office, however, general seating areas and waiting rooms are not present at the station. Although staff help isn't available, customer help points and assistance from the train guard are accessible for travelers requiring additional support.

Your Journey Beyond Whitton Station

For those planning onward travel from Whitton, the station is well-connected with various transport modes. Bus services facilitate easy transit to local destinations such as Hounslow, Twickenham, and Feltham, with stops conveniently located on High Street. While there are no dedicated cycle hire facilities, the station does offer ample bicycle storage with 32 spaces right at the booking hall entrance.

If you're keen on exploring more, the station serves as a great starting point to travel to popular destinations such as London Waterloo, Vauxhall, and the charming Richmond. Everything you need to know about Baillieston Station

Discovering Baillieston Train Station

Nestled in the east of Glasgow, Baillieston Train Station serves as a convenient gateway to the city and beyond for local residents and travelers alike. This station provides essential services to make your journey smooth and efficient. While it might not boast the amenities of larger stations, it offers a charming, peaceful ambiance perfect for hassle-free travel.

Facilities at Baillieston Station

Though Baillieston Train Station does not have a ticket office, it is equipped with accessible ticket machines, including those for online ticket collection, ensuring passengers can grab their tickets quickly and easily. The station lacks a staff presence, but it does offer help points if you need further guidance. For safety, the station is equipped with CCTV. However, do note that there are no luggage storage facilities available here.

Accessibility is a priority at Baillieston, with step-free access available to both platforms. While passengers can make use of the customer help points, some facilities such as toilets and waiting rooms are not available. Although there is seating available at the station, there are no lounges or refreshment facilities.

Onward Travel Options

For those continuing their journey or planning local travel, Baillieston provides several onward travel options. Bus services are accessible from Caledonia Road, with further details available at Traveline Scotland. Taxis can be hired via TrainTaxi, a useful service for seamless onward rides.
